Understanding Sexual Assault Laws in South Carolina

In South Carolina, understanding sexual assault laws is paramount for survivors seeking justice. A sexual abuse lawyer South Carolina plays a crucial role in navigating this complex landscape, ensuring survivors’ rights are protected. The state’s legal framework recognizes various forms of sexual misconduct, including rape, criminal sexual conduct, and sexual battery. These offenses are categorized based on the age of the victim and the perpetrator’s relationship to them, with stricter penalties for more severe crimes. For instance, a conviction for criminal sexual conduct in the first degree, involving a minor, carries a mandatory life sentence.
Survivors should be aware that South Carolina has strict statutes of limitations for filing charges, which can vary depending on the type of offense. This means timely action is essential. A qualified sexual assault attorney South Carolina can help navigate these legal intricacies, providing crucial guidance on whether a case is strong enough to pursue and advising on potential outcomes. They can also assist in gathering evidence, dealing with law enforcement, and representing the survivor in court.
